Overview

μ's →NEXT LoveLive! 2014 ~ENDLESS PARADE~ is a DVD/Blu-Ray disc of μ's live concert that took place in Saitama Super Arena on February 8th and 9th, 2014. Day One was split into three parts and released separately coupled with the 2nd, 4th and 6th TV Anime 2 Blu-ray Volumes, while the DVD and Blu-ray for Day 2 was released on July 23, 2014. This was their first concert to be live-streamed not just in cinemas across Japan, but also to cinemas in other countries.
